NEW owners have saved a historic site from potential developers.

The Ravenswood Country House Inn, Sharpthorne, near East Grinstead had started to close down and plans were going ahead to convert the building into residential units.

But East Grinstead-based Samantha Wordie of Samantha Wordie Photography and businessman Stuart Guy have now purchased the business.

Samantha noticed that The Ravenswood website was down while trying to find a wedding venue for a couple, and she called to find out why.

She was told it was being sold, at which point she got in touch with her businessman friend, Stuart Guy, who got together with her and other friends to save it.

She said: “Stuart and I had been looking for a venue to buy for a few years.

“When we found out The Ravenswood was being sold and possibly converted into apartments, we decided the place was too beautiful to be lost to developers and we got together to save it!

“It all happened by chance!

“I have many years of experience in the wedding business, and I have always wanted to run my own dream wedding venue.

“With all its character, charm and history, that’s exactly what The Ravenswood is – not only for weddings but also for parties, conferences, concerts and all manner of other events.

“This is a dream come true for Stuart and me. We want people to know we’re fully open for business.”
